Description

A new, revised, and expanded edition of the Czech etymological dictionary for the general public. For this new edition, new entries have been added, some entries have been fundamentally changed, and approximately 1000 entries have been revised. The century of the first recorded occurrence of a word in Czech is now indicated in the entries. Indo-European roots are reconstructed in their laryngeal form, based on the currently widely accepted laryngeal theory. The latest etymological dictionary of the Czech language brings more than 11,000 basic entries focused on both common vocabulary and newly borrowed and non-standard words, approximately 21,000 derived words, and nearly 64,000 references to words from other languages, an overview of the most important phonetic changes from the Indo-European proto-language to Czech, and a kinship classification of languages worldwide. The dictionary is intended for philologists, lexicographers, historians, archivists, as well as translators, journalists, educators, students, and other cultural workers, as well as all interested members of the general public.
